The philosophy in tomorrow is not always for tomorrow but for  just today.THE BEST  TOMORROW IS TODAY! In my understanding of TOMORROW,i have found out that it is a fearful thing for every being to think about their TOMORROW, in short, let me say everyone is afraid of the uncertain tomorrow.
The Bible talked about TOMORROW,in Proverbs27:1 "  Boast not thyself of tomorrow; for thou knowest not what a day may bring forth."
That's the pin-point, which God through His wisdom He gave King Solomon which made him revealed this truth.This scripture  here told us not to boast of thyself about tomorrow.The key here is boasting.The Bible did not ask you not share your dreams.You may share dreams with closed families,lovers and well wishers.Those whom you know could help  achieve your dreams why not share your dreams with them.However sharing dreams should not bring boasting.You are to be plain. and come up with the facts which are going to be glorifying to God himself  and his Christ only.
It looks as if we talk TOMORROW as if in future but,no, it is today.As you boast on your future thinking you are preparing your TOMORROW,you have damaged your tomorrow from your today.
Apostle James also revealed this basic truth by shedding light on it  by his comprehensive details on why not to boast of TOMORROW. JAMES 4:13- 17:
13"Now listen, you who say, “Today or tomorrow we will go to this or that city, spend a year there, carry on business and make money.” 14Why, you do not even know what will happen tomorrow. What is your life? You are a mist that appears for a little while and then vanishes. 15Instead, you ought to say, “If it is the Lord’s will, we will live and do this or that.” 16As it is, you boast and brag. All such boasting is evil. 17Anyone, then, who knows the good he ought to do and doesn’t do it, sins."
